PHN Immunisation training needs
Published 01 March 2024

The Benchmarque Group have been fortunate to work with a range of Organisations to support over 2000 Registered Nurses/Midwives to become Authorised/Endorsed Nurse Immunisers over the past two years.

Working directly with Organisations has allowed us to deliver both nationally accredited education that leads to a recognised qualification, as well as bespoke learning opportunities to address specific needs within geographic areas.

Over the past two years, we have been engaged by 18 of the 31 Primary Health Networks (PHNs) to provide Immunisation Endorsement/Authorisation qualifications for Registered Nurses and Midwives. 

One of the benefits of working with us, besides the high quality of our courses, is that we have been able to absorb most of the administrative burden. Generally, a PHN has identified individuals they would like to support (e.g., via an Expression of Interest (EOI) process), and our Student Experience team have commenced enrolments, answered student queries, followed up with individuals, and reported to the PHN on enrolment, progress, and completion.

Benchmarque Group have two main offerings in the space of Immunisation:

  • Immunisation Clinical Pathway (for clinicians who are required to administer vaccinations under the direct order of a Medical Officer as part of their scope of practice)
  • Immunisation Endorsement Pathway (for Registered Nurses and Midwives who want the ability to immunise independent of a Medical Officer.)
